Split Cord Malformations

摘要

Split cord malformations are one of rare and complex occult spinal dysraphism in which spinal cord divided into two symmetrical or non-symmetrical parts by medium septa which may be fibrous or bony (Meena RK, Doddamani RS, Sharma R. World Neurosurg 2019; Gezercan Y, Özsoy KM, Oktay K, Çetinalp NE, Erman T, Zeren M. Çukurova Üniversitesi 199:40, 2015). There are two types of SCMs. Type I SCM (diastematomyelia) is characterized by osseocartilaginous septum that divides spinal canal and spinal cord into two parts surrounded by separated thecal sacs. Type II SCM (diplomyelia) is characterized by medium fibrous septum that separate spinal cord into two parts within single thecal sac and spinal canal (Raskin JS, Litvack ZN, Selden NR. Split spinal cord, Youmans and Winn neurological surgery. Elsevier, Philadelphia, 2017; 3322–3330). The most commonly accepted theory is Unified theory by Pang in which the basic error occurred during gastrulation in which midline integration of notochord failed so that the ectoderm-endoderm adhesion persists by the unfused heminotochords that causes an accessory neurenteric canal (ANC) formation around which an endomesenchymal tract condensed and pass through the heminotochord leading to formation of hemineural plates. In general, clinical presentations categorized into: (1) skin lesions (2) back pain and (3) neurolagical deficits (due to spinal cord tethering) or patient may be asymptomatic. These lesions are best demonstrated by MRI, CT, sometimes CT myelography. When the diagnosis of split cord is confirmed in a child, prophylactic surgery is indicated because neurological deterioration is very common. The main aim of surgery is resection of median septum and any tethering bands.
